How Does Expanded Polystyrene Help You With Product Packaging?

If you own a business that sells breakable items, you’ll want to give every one of them every inch of protection they deserve. This article explains how polystyrene plays a crucial role in this, so you can be confident that all your goods are well protected.

Have you ever thought about how expanded polystyrene can make all the difference between an object going through the post in one piece or several? The manufacture of polystyrene is a major business and it isn’t hard to see why. Many businesses require expanded polystyrene to make sure their goods are not damaged in transit, and without it they would undoubtedly have more breakages than they do now.

The good news is the manufacture of polystyrene can be done in lots of different ways. For example packing peanuts can be created to give a loose fill around fragile items, particularly those that are of an odd shape. Another possibility is to have packaging specially made for certain items. This means you can then have an outer box with promotional writing and images on it and the item safely stored inside. It also means you can easily send out each box in the post as required, without worrying about additional packaging.

As you can see, many businesses would struggle without some form of polystyrene available to protect their goods. In fact we would have many more damaged items than we do already, owing to the lack of protection they would have.
